Answer: The bus company charges $300 for 50 people.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we have given that

Number of people = 30

Charged by the bus company = $180

If the number of people = 50

Let the charges by the bus company be 'x'.

According to question, it becomes,

[tex]\dfrac{180}{30}=\dfrac{x}{50}\\\\6\times 50=x\\\\\$300=x[/tex]

Hence, the bus company charges $300 for 50 people.
